Held every weekend at the historic Pearl Brewery complex, this bustling farmers market is more than just a source for fresh produce—it’s a community gathering spot where local farmers, bakers, and artisans come together. According to Eater and Condé Nast Traveler, the Pearl Farmers Market is the best way to taste San Antonio’s evolving food culture, offering everything from heritage grains to small-batch salsas and live music in a family-friendly setting.
